Tornado Cash has surged into the limelight of the copyright community, sparking intense discussion about its implications for privacy. This decentralized platform, built on Ethereum, facilitates users to conceal the origins and destinations of their copyright transactions, effectively offering a layer of security against conventional financial monitoring. While proponents hail it as a vital tool for financialautonomy, critics express worries about its potential use in underhanded activities.

Muddying the Lines: Tornado Cash and On-Chain Anonymity

The copyright realm embraces a level of anonymity unmatched in traditional finance. This possibility is both alluring and polarizing, particularly when considering tools like Tornado Cash. This service allows users to mask their on-chain transactions, effectively removing their trail. While proponents champion this as a vital feature for privacy and security, critics raise alarms about its potential for illegal activity.

Concisely, Tornado Cash represents a point in the ongoing debate surrounding on-chain anonymity. Can this instrument truly be a force for good, or does it create the way for increased illegality? The answer remains elusive, complicating the already murky landscape of copyright.

The Gathering Tempest: Governing Decentralized Mixing Networks

The landscape of online privacy is constantly evolving, with new technologies emerging to protect user data. Decentralized mixing services, designed to anonymize internet traffic and shield users from monitoring, are one such innovation. However, this innovative approach also presents unique challenges for regulators struggling to balance privacy protections with the need to combat online crime. As these services become more commonplace, the debate over their regulation is intensifying.

Governments worldwide are grappling with how to effectively regulate these decentralized platforms. The inherent anonymity of mixing networks makes it challenging to identify malicious actors and hinder illicit activities such as malicious behavior.

Additionally, the global nature of these services hinders efforts to establish a unified regulatory framework. A holistic approach, involving collaboration between governments, industry stakeholders, and privacy advocates, may be necessary to address this complex issue effectively.
